What is Retinol?

Retinoids, or retinol, is an umbrella term for compounds that feature vitamin A. It has anti-ageing properties, helps unclog pores, and evens out your overall complexion. So, what does retinol do? A retinol serum’s main purpose is to stimulate collagen production in the skin, which is naturally occurring but begins to decline in your mid-20s. This helps produce a natural, healthy glow and reduces the appearance of fine lines.

How Often Should You Use Retinol

The ideal time to start using retinoids is in your mid-20s when your natural collagen production starts to plateau and decline. When you first start, it’s important to ease into retinoid usage so as not to overwhelm or dry out your skin. We recommend using half a pump of Granactive Retinoid® serum every other day and gradually build up to daily use after 2-4 weeks.

How Long Does Retinol Take to Work?

It can take a few months to see the effects of retinoids on your skin, but it’s well worth sticking it out! Even though it starts working right away, and you may see results sooner, you should allow at least 12 weeks of proper retinoid use before expecting to see major changes in your skin.
